Send Money at FMC Lexington 

How to deposit funds, commissary, and payment options

Overview

FMC Lexington accepts MoneyGram deposits, but the details must be entered exactly right. Format the account number as the inmate's eight-digit register number immediately followed by their last name (example: 12345678DOE). Use MoneyGram Receive Code 7932. Funds sent between 7:00 a.m. and 9:00 p.m. EST typically post within 2–4 hours. Transfers after 9:00 p.m. post at 7:00 a.m. the next morning. Other deposit methods—vendor portals, lobby kiosks, phone deposits, or mailed money orders—may be available, so check the vendor or facility page for options.
